A drainage network sedimentation management method based on a large Internet of Things (IoT) model is provided. The method includes: acquiring flow data of a pipe section; determining a flow cross-sectional area series of a plurality of adjacent pipe sections based on the flow data of the pipe section; determining a target detection area and a target detection time based on the flow cross-sectional area series of the plurality of adjacent pipe sections; controlling a robot to perform sonar detection on the target detection area at the target detection time, and acquiring sonar detection data; determining a sedimentation risk based on the sonar detection data and pipe characteristics; automatically generating a desilting path and desilting parameters based on the sedimentation risk; controlling automated desilting equipment to travel along the desilting path to a desilting operation point, and performing a desilting operation based on the desilting parameters.
